» PESH Student to attend President Obama's State of the Union Address
By Plano ISD | Published 01/24/2011 | Education | Unrated

This past week junior Amy Chyao received a telephone call at school from the White House and learned that President Obama has invited her to Washington D.C.  to attend and sit with the First Lady at his State of the Union Address Tuesday night.
Amy is being invited as recognition of her winning overall first place in the International Science & Engineering Fair last spring. This is her second invitation from the President; she presented her science fair project to him at the White House this fall.
President Obama's State of the Union Address will be televised locally at 8:00 p.m. Tuesday evening on every major network. What an incredible honor this is for our Plano East Panther, Amy Chyao.

» Plano East to Cancel Classes on Tuesday, November 23
By Plano ISD | Published 11/22/2010 | Education | Unrated

\"\"Plano East Senior High School Principal Karen McDonald has announced that the school has received a second bomb threat. Although the threat is not credible, in an abundance of caution, classes will be canceled for Tuesday, November 23.

The cancellation of school will enable the district to completely sweep the building with the canine units.  Plano ISD is continuing to work with the Plano Police Department to follow up on strong leads in both instances.

Although we are not required to make up school for Tuesday\'s closure, any subsequent time lost due to these types of threats will be made up.

» WHICH HIGH SCHOOL WILL MILLER FEED INTO?
By Plano ISD | Published 12/3/2009 | Education | Interest Level:

The Plano ISD Board of Trustees met in a regular work session on Tuesday, November 17, to discuss the feeder alignment process that the district is undergoing in preparation of the opening of Otto Middle School and McMillen High School in 2010 and 2011, respectively.  These decisions will directly affect the direction that our Miller Mustangs will take upon completion of elementary school.

Having met within their board subcommittees during the previous weeks, the trustees are pursuing study of a plan, referred to as "Option 3" at the work session, and are seeking additional community input before their formal vote scheduled for December 15. Option 3 would convert Williams High School to an academy program for ninth through twelfth graders.

The December 15 board meeting remains confirmed for 7:00 p.m. at Sockwell Center (the closed session will begin at 6:00 p.m.).
